The Qingci Games Inc. (HKG:6633) share price has fared very poorly over the last month, falling by a substantial 27%. Longer-term shareholders would now have taken a real hit with the stock declining 3.3% in the last year.

In spite of the heavy fall in price, you could still be forgiven for thinking Qingci Games is a stock not worth researching with a price-to-sales ratios (or "P/S") of 3.1x, considering almost half the companies in Hong Kong's Entertainment industry have P/S ratios below 1.9x. However, the P/S might be high for a reason and it requires further investigation to determine if it's justified.

Is There Enough Revenue Growth Forecasted For Qingci Games?

The only time you'd be truly comfortable seeing a P/S as high as Qingci Games' is when the company's growth is on track to outshine the industry.

Taking a look back first, the company's revenue growth last year wasn't something to get excited about as it posted a disappointing decline of 42%. This means it has also seen a slide in revenue over the longer-term as revenue is down 13% in total over the last three years. Therefore, it's fair to say the revenue growth recently has been undesirable for the company.

In contrast to the company, the rest of the industry is expected to grow by 10% over the next year, which really puts the company's recent medium-term revenue decline into perspective.

With this in mind, we find it worrying that Qingci Games' P/S exceeds that of its industry peers. It seems most investors are ignoring the recent poor growth rate and are hoping for a turnaround in the company's business prospects. Only the boldest would assume these prices are sustainable as a continuation of recent revenue trends is likely to weigh heavily on the share price eventually.

The Key Takeaway

Despite the recent share price weakness, Qingci Games' P/S remains higher than most other companies in the industry. Typically, we'd caution against reading too much into price-to-sales ratios when settling on investment decisions, though it can reveal plenty about what other market participants think about the company.

We've established that Qingci Games currently trades on a much higher than expected P/S since its recent revenues have been in decline over the medium-term. With a revenue decline on investors' minds, the likelihood of a souring sentiment is quite high which could send the P/S back in line with what we'd expect. Unless the recent medium-term conditions improve markedly, investors will have a hard time accepting the share price as fair value.
